The sounds of key clicks give you some haptic feedback. But it can get annoying if you are a good touch typist or want to type in silence.
The On-Screen Keyboard (OSK) is an accessibility feature on Windows 10.
Turning the sound off on the OSK takes a few steps. Follow the same steps to switch on the keyboard sounds if you want.

On-Screen keyboards make a sound for every keypress. This is handy especially for those who need assistance but can be annoying because the sound can interrupt your work and others who may be near you. So you have two options. One, you plug in your earphone and type, or you can choose to turn off keyboard sounds on your Windows 10 PC.
